One of the standout features of El Capitan is its extensive seafood menu. From the crispy Chicharrón De Pescado for $19.19 to the sumptuous El Faro Shrimp plate boasting a medley of shrimp, surimi, scallops, and octopus at $32.39, there’s something that caters to every seafood lover's palate. Their ceviche selection is particularly noteworthy, with options like the Hot Cheeto Ceviche for $20.39 and the classic Ceviche El Capitan at $20.39 promising a burst of freshness and flavor. Many patrons rave about the Ostiones Empanizados and Empanadas De Camarón, both priced at $15.59, delivering that authentic taste of ocean delight.

For those who appreciate sushi, the restaurant does not disappoint either. With rolls like the 3 Quesos Roll ($15.59) and Mar Y Tierra Roll ($16.79), every bite is an explosion of taste and creativity. Guests have enjoyed pairing their meals with El Capitan’s specialty cocktails, which include the flavorful Coctel De Camarón ($19.19) and Coctel De Pulpo ($22.79), providing a refreshing sip to complement the exquisite dining experience.
